Keith's new wheels

7 August 2019
News

With an eye for detail, Keith wanted to explore a hobby that would capture his interest and one which he could apply his skills. When he stumbled across building model cars... there was no going back.

Despite the fiddly nature of the models, Keith was in love. Lee, who supports Keith, explained:

"The level of concentration and the intricate building would defeat most patient people, but Keith met the challenge with all 8 fiddly fingers and 2 thumbs and built his model to a professional standard. Keith enjoyed this so much he has been out and bought 2 more."

Keith’s newest venture was inspired by the #TrySomethingNew movement, introduced by Andrea Parr, MacIntyre’s Area Manager for Warrington, which continues to inspire people across MacIntyre.

Since then, Keith has even expanded to model planes too.
